Topps Chrome Black 2025: Darker Aesthetic, Expanded Cards, Timeless Style

In an era where every new baseball card set seems to dazzle the eyes with neon glitz and a full spectrum of prisms, there’s one collection that stands apart by steering clear of chasing rainbows—it’s the 2025 Topps Chrome Black Baseball set. True to its legacy, Chrome Black enters the scene holding firm to its moody, compelling aesthetic—a nod to collectors who savor darkness over dazzle. With an air of quiet sophistication, it returns with some much-appreciated tweaks that enhance the experience without betraying its signature style.

To all those familiar with the 2024 set, Chrome Black’s penchant for minimalism has been one of its strongest suits. In a refreshing yet meaningful shift, the 2025 edition redesigns its hobby box configuration, inviting collectors into a more satisfying unboxing experience. Previously, collectors faced the recurring challenge posed by the limited four-card package. This year, however, Topps turns up the volume—each hobby box now neatly boosts its offerings with two packs, housing a generous seven cards each, and a cherry on top: a separately packed, encased autograph. This clever compositional change increases the total card count to 15 per box. It’s a subtle nod to quantity that never detracts from the product’s minimalist soul, encouraging more tactile delight without compromising that premium feel aficionados expect.

The essence of 2025 Topps Chrome Black is steeped in the present while revering its past. With a 150-card base set, it wisely focuses its lens exclusively on current veterans and rookies. Yet, it offers a touch of nostalgia, reserving spaces for iconic retired figures solely in its autograph ranks. It is an apt move for collectors who lean towards the excitement of the present-day roster rather than being steeped in yesteryears. Its defining look—a deep black canvas and razor-sharp edges—continues to etch its place in the market’s visual elite, delivering a polished aura that almost feels like an enduring fashion statement.

The revered highlight within this collection invariably lies in the encased autograph cards. The 2025 lineup impressively enhances this aspect, ensuring that these autographs, more than mere token throws, command attention. Spanning the gamut from reliable stalwarts to promising upstarts, these on-card signatures are not your average finds. The autograph checklist is rich, bolstered by themed subsets like the Super Futures Autographs—a nod to burgeoning stars; the starkly contrasting Ivory Autographs; and the dramatic Pitch Black Pairings, each contributing dual-signed flair to the lineup. The diversity and depth within these themes ensure there’s always a surprise lurking within every box.

True to its character, Topps Chrome Black adds layers with its insert sets, offering yet another platform for pushing aesthetic limits. Sets like Depth of Darkness, Hit the Lights, and the aptly named Nocturnal stand as testament to the line’s commitment to its mystique-driven identity. Furthermore, even variations for rookies don’t shy away from embracing that ingrained Chrome Black twist—an attention to detail that continues to impress those who relish a stylish stack.

Now, inevitably, the spoils await in each hobby box. If anticipation is an art, Topps Chrome Black masters it with its promise of pulling at least one Encased On-Card Autograph and an enticing array of 14 base or insert cards. With renowned names scattered across the slate, it’s an evocative showcase—superstars like Shohei Ohtani, promising appearances from Elly De La Cruz, Aaron Judge, Bobby Witt Jr., and burgeoning talents like Jackson Holliday keep the excitement percolating. Rookies, as well, aren’t left behind. With names such as Paul Skenes and Junior Caminero making the scene, there’s ample allure driving the hunt.

For the anticipatory, checklist mappers, the full card roster promises a gratifying treasure hunt. However, the print runs for non-serial numbered treasures remain as shadowy and undecipherable as ever, fostering just enough mystery to stir collectors into action.
